Output 8a89daac112b6083342fb0ea7c2c4dd27eaa27546695bc5752bd57b7b5b77093:7
- value
- 43029522
- script pubkey
- OP_0 OP_PUSHBYTES_20 05fd46f300c3e90172908383d81a201d8debc3e0
- address
- bc1qqh75ducqc05szu5sswpasx3qrkx7hslqaes4hl
- transaction
- 8a89daac112b6083342fb0ea7c2c4dd27eaa27546695bc5752bd57b7b5b77093